For Question 11: In the scientific method, the initial step of identifying and stating a specific phenomenon that leads to a research question is defined as observation.
For Question 12: The description matches a scientific theory, which is a well-supported, general explanation of natural phenomena built from consistent, reproducible observations, and is more robust than a single hypothesis.
